Erro quando mudei targetSdkVersion para 31

hoshin

Member
Olá pessoal.
Quando fiz a mudança do targetSdkVersion para trabalhar com app 31, passou a apresentar a seguinte mensagem quando faço o Upload do app para a Google Play:
Você fez upload de um APK ou Android App Bundle que tem uma atividade, um alias da atividade, um serviço ou um broadcast receiver com um filtro de intent, mas sem a propriedade "android:exported" definida. O arquivo não pode ser instalado no Android 12 ou mais recente. Acesse: developer.android.com/about/versions/12/behavior-changes-12#exported

Mas se eu for no Manifest, existe a opção android:exported definida.
Alguém passou por esse problema?

Segue abaixo o Manifest para vocês darem uma olhada.

'This code will be applied to the manifest file during compilation.
'You do not need to modify it in most cases.
'See this link for for more information: https://www.b4x.com/forum/showthread.php?p=78136
AddManifestText(
<uses-sdk android:minSdkVersion="5" android:targetSdkVersion="31"/>
<supports-screens android:largeScreens="true"
android:normalScreens="true"
android:smallScreens="true"
android:anyDensity="true"/>)
SetApplicationAttribute(android:icon, "@drawable/icon")
SetApplicationAttribute(android:label, "$LABEL$")
CreateResourceFromFile(Macro, Themes.DarkTheme)
SetApplicationAttribute(android:usesCleartextTraffic, "true")
AddPermission("android.permission.READ_CONTACTS")
AddPermission("android.permission.WRITE_CONTACTS")
AddPermission(android.permission.REQUEST_INSTALL_PACKAGES)
AddPermission(android.permission.CHANGE_WIFI_MULTICAST_STATE)
AddPermission(android.permission.SYSTEM_ALERT_WINDOW)
'End of default text.

'======================================================================
'PARA A BIBLIOTECA FILEPROVIDER
AddApplicationText(
<provider
android:name="android.support.v4.content.FileProvider"
android:authorities="$PACKAGE$.provider"
android:exported="false"
android:grantUriPermissions="true">
<meta-data
android:name="android.support.FILE_PROVIDER_PATHS"
android:resource="@xml/provider_paths"/>
</provider>
)
CreateResource(xml, provider_paths,
<files-path name="name" path="shared" />
)
'======================================================================
 
Top